Key considerations for buying a condo in Mount Pleasant Mills include: Review at least 3 years of HOA meeting minutes for hidden issues; Check the reserve fund percentage (ideally 70%+ funded); Verify what insurance the HOA covers vs. what you need. Also watch for red flags like HOA with less than 50% reserves and Multiple units for sale in same building (could indicate problems).

Some condos may not be FHA or VA approved - check early Non-warrantable condos require conventional financing with higher down payments With Mount Pleasant Mills's median price of $280K, you'll want to get pre-approved early to understand your budget.
January is the current seasonal value signal for condos in Mount Pleasant Mills, but the least competitive month can shift with mortgage rates, new listings, and local inventory. Track days on market and price cuts before making an offer.
A lower offer may make sense when the property has been listed longer than the local average of 70 days, has visible repair needs, or recently had a price reduction. In faster markets, strengthen the offer with clean terms rather than relying only on price.
